What Is Telegram and How Does It Differ From Other Platforms?
Telegram is a cloud-based messaging service known for its emphasis on security and flexibility. Unlike traditional social media platforms, it allows users to create private groups, channels, and encrypted “Secret Chats.” These features make it a popular choice for communities seeking controlled access to information. For obituaries, this means users can share sensitive content with specific audiences while maintaining a level of anonymity or discretion.
Key Features Relevant to Obituary Sharing
Encrypted Communication: Protects sensitive information from unauthorized access. Public and Private Groups: Enables targeted sharing with family, friends, or broader communities. Cloud Storage: Allows long-term preservation of documents, photos, and videos.

Legal and Cultural Implications of Digital Obituaries
Laws governing digital memorials vary by jurisdiction. In some cases, unauthorized sharing of obituaries may infringe on privacy rights or copyright protections. Users should familiarize themselves with local regulations before posting content online. Additionally, cultural attitudes toward death and remembrance influence the appropriateness of public digital tributes.
Best Practices for Legal Compliance
Obtain consent from next of kin before publishing obituaries. - Avoid sharing copyrighted material without permission. - Consult legal experts for complex cases involving estates or inheritance.
